## 2024-11 Key Rotation — ParityScout

Rotated the signing key for ParityScout, our hotel rate-parity checker. Old key retired after the Brightmoor incident review flagged stale credentials on the scraper fleet. All crawler nodes now verify manifests against the new key before pulling rate snapshots from partner feeds.

Action required: update your local verifier config before your next deploy. Builds signed with the old key will fail CI as of Friday. Ask Della on the platform team if rotation scripts error out.

The current signing key is:

release key, fahog-tagef: bky4_Dq9e

**Wiki: Break-Glass Access — Fernmap Offline Mode**

If a field crew is stuck offline and their Fernmap sync token expires mid-survey, on-call can grant break-glass access without the auth service. Don't do this casually — it bypasses audit hooks until the next sync. Open the admin panel, pick "offline override," and when prompted, enter the recovery passphrase printed directly below.

recovery phrase for bawif-hahif: ralael-tamdor

Welcome to the Cachewell team. We place a bloom filter in front of the Pondstore key-value cluster to avoid disk lookups for absent keys; false positives are tolerated, false negatives are not. Rebuilding the filter requires access to the snapshot archive. That archive unlocks with the recovery passphrase below.

unlock words, kajef-kadug: sorys-pelax-lamael-tamvan-briiel-novdor-fenwyn-tamdor-oliion-keleth-julok-belion-ralok

## 2024-06 — Cron migration to Loomflow

We moved the nightly cron jobs from the legacy scheduler into the Loomflow workflow engine. As part of this, the setting SCHED_SECRET was renamed to LOOMFLOW_WORKER_SECRET; the old key is no longer read anywhere. New team members bootstrapping a local environment should copy env.sample, delete any SCHED_SECRET leftovers, and then append the renamed entry on the next line:

sealed setting: ARCHIVE_KEY3=8d0